Atomic Force Microscopes and AFM Systems manufactured by AFMWorkshop are designed with the essential scanning features for obtaining high-quality AFM images at high resolution, along with a flexible scanning software developed in LabVIEW.

 
These modular AFMs are useful in a variety of research, industry, and educational settings. Applications include nanotechnology, life sciences and biology research; process development and control; polymer characterization, and other areas of science and engineering. With a vertical resolution as low as 0.08 nanometers, these atomic force microscopes offer the highest performance to price ratio in the industry.
B-AFM
The B-AFM is a complete system that includes a computer with software, a stage, and control electronics; everything needed for AFM scanning. The electronics are located at the rear of the B-AFM stage, and only a single USB cable is connected between the computer and the stage. For scientists and engineers with bigger ideas than budgets.
TT-2 AFM
This compact, second generation high resolution tabletop Atomic Force Microscope (AFM) has all the important features and benefits expected from a light lever AFM. The TT-2 AFM includes a stage, control electronics, probes, manuals, and a video microscope.
NP-AFM
The NP-AFM is a nanoprofiler for analysis of features such as surface roughness and metrology of technical samples. Primary applications for the NP-AFM include process development and process control of technical samples.
LS-AFM
The LS-AFM is used in life sciences applications when an inverted optical microscope is required for locating cells or other bio-materials on a surface. The LS-AFM can be retrofitted to almost any inverted optical microscope, or it can be purchased with the AFMWorkshop inverted optical microscope.
SA-AFM
Because the probe on the SA-AFM extends below the stage structure the SA-AFM is capable of scanning all sizes and shapes of samples. The SA-AFM includes a direct drive Z approach motor, high resolution on axis video microscope, linearized piezo XYZ scanner, and an industry standard light lever.
